EonPredict: Real-Time Fatigue Accident Prevention
The ultimate autonomous clinical screening. EonPredict non-invasively evaluates physiological parameters of the autonomic nervous system in 30 seconds, predicting risks of attentional fatigue and motor impairment before the start of high-risk tasks.
30-Second Biological Validation
Mathematical analysis of heart rate variability (HRV) and eye fatigue using dry-contact sensors and infrared cameras.
Automated Entry Synchronization
Integrated with physical turnstiles and RFID gate access control. Blocks entry to the operational area upon detection of a critical risk.

How does EonClinic complement EonPredict to protect populations?
EonClinic (with its Lab, Occupational Health, and Telemedicine modules) integrates directly and bidirectionally via EonClinic Lab's HL7 FHIR R5 connector. When EonPredict detects a critical shift in pre-shift physiological metrics (disrupted sleep, motor asymmetry, autonomic fatigue), the alert is injected directly into the patient's clinical file, enabling on-site physicians to perform an immediate virtual triage and proactively retire the operator or athlete before activities begin.

Why is native connection to HL7 FHIR R5 indispensable?
The HL7 FHIR R5 standard represents the global vanguard of clinical data interoperability. It enables the secure, seamless, and instantaneous transfer of medical records and biometric telemetry between independent platforms and legacy hospital network servers (Epic, Cerner), eliminating integration friction and ensuring the scientific integrity of population health data.
